Jon's Current Read

Friendly Native Beach Resort is a small, beach-adjacent pocket in St Pete Beach with 63 homes and stock that dates from 1949 to 1992, a median build year of 1977. At that age, price here is driven less by square footage and more by condition, updates, and how the seawall, roof, and systems have held up. With a median of roughly 1,160 living square feet, these are compact homes, so what has been done inside a given unit will swing value more than the number of bedrooms.

The trading picture is thin: only 2 closings in the window we track. That is too few to call a trend, so treat any price signal as a wide, condition-dependent spread rather than a firm market rate. For buyers, that means each listing has to be underwritten on its own merits. For sellers, it means comps are scarce and presentation and inspection-readiness do more work than they would in a deeper market.

A small, older beach pocket that trades on condition

The homestead share sits at about 22%, which tells you most of these 63 homes are held as something other than a primary residence, a common pattern in a beach location. That mix has practical consequences: a large slice of the stock may be run as second homes or rentals, so upkeep and interior updates vary widely from one property to the next. Underwrite the specific home, not the block.

Because the building era runs 1949 to 1992, you are buying into an established, built-out area rather than new construction. Expect to evaluate roof age, windows, plumbing and electrical, and any coastal-exposure items closely. The compact median footprint near 1,160 square feet rewards buyers who value location and a manageable structure over size, and it rewards sellers who have documented their improvements.

The location and the amenities are priced into every listing in Friendly Native Beach Resort. The deal is won or lost on condition, the comps, and the renovation math.
